The KEI (Keyword Effectiveness Index) is the square of the popularity of a keyword multiplied by 1000 and divided by the number of sites that appear in search engines for that keyword. It is invented to measure which keywords are worth optimising your site for and is mostly used by Search Engine Optimizers (SEO). The higher the KEI, better the keyword for your website.
